The wind and rain brought ___ into the river. Over time, that material may form layers and harden into rock.
Vesnalui [34]
The answer is sediment.
There are three types of rocks: sedimentary, igneous, and metamorphic. The only one that would make sense here is sedimentary because the question states a rock that is made from layers is formed which describes a sedimentary rock.
